I'm trying to find out how to determine which woods will darken over time.
I know Cherry and Mahogany do, but which others and why? The reason for
my question is I'm building a couple of things from Walnut and I'm not
sure how much the color will change over time and the person I'm making
these things for was asking.


I do not know of any wood that will not darken if exposed to "sun light".
Maple will darken if exposed to sun light.



Walnut, especially kiln-dried walnut, will lighten to a tan color,
will it not? Certainly seems to be my experience.

Purpleheart will eventually fade to some kind of brown or tan.
